What they do

A Director of Operations is responsible for the day-to-day operations of a company or organization. Plans, organizes, directs and evaluates delivery of goods and services. Supervises staff, oversee projects and daily work activities. May have responsibility for managing supplies and materials, budgets or customer relations; may serve as liaison to senior management.

$151,481 / year median in Illinois

+6% projected growth

Position Summary Omaha Track is seeking a Director of Chicago Heights Operations to lead and grow our Chicago market. This senior leadership position is responsible for expanding our transloading, drayage, intermodal, trucking, and equipment repair operations while driving new business and building a high-performing team. This is an entrepreneurial role for a proven leader who thrives on developing business, improving operations, and creating long-term growth. The Director will oversee the Chicago Heights facility with full P&L responsibility and play a key role in strengthening Omaha Track's presence throughout the Chicago logistics and railroad market. What You'll Do Drive business development and revenue growth across transloading, drayage, intermodal, trucking, and railroad material services. Build and maintain strong relationships with railroads, shippers, brokers, and logistics partners throughout the Chicago market. Lead day-to-day operations of the Chicago Heights facility, ensuring safe, efficient, and customer-focused performance. Develop and grow an equipment repair and service business utilizing existing shop facilities. Recruit, coach, and lead a high-performing operations team, including Shop, Yard, and Logistics Managers. Manage the facility's operating budget, financial performance, and capital improvements. Collaborate with executive leadership to execute strategic initiatives and expand Omaha Track's market presence. What We're Looking For 10+ years of progressive leadership experience in trucking, drayage, intermodal, transloading, rail, or logistics operations. Proven success driving business development and growing revenue. Experience managing large operations with P&L responsibility. Strong leadership, team-building, and operational management skills. Existing relationships within the Chicago railroad or logistics industry are highly preferred. Bachelor's degree in Business, Logistics, Supply Chain, or a related field preferred.
